Transaction 209830a21a58e3002465b0b06a5ea4d0bbd82497144b87a0407a3e64cc4382a6

2 Input
2 Outputs
  • 209830a21a58e3002465b0b06a5ea4d0bbd82497144b87a0407a3e64cc4382a6:0
  • value  34700
    address  34DWHP8yMeGtUdsJiL5dp5hQVCgEpvLRQ2
  • 209830a21a58e3002465b0b06a5ea4d0bbd82497144b87a0407a3e64cc4382a6:1
  • value  1038715
    address  36Ku1tkWXpT8g4tjofvqtmHxX72pzJfSEU